This past weekend I noticed a couple broken hairs while finger combing my hair. It wasn't many broken hairs but enough to make me realize that I'm in need of a stronger protein treatment. Plus, I relaxed approx. 1 wk ago, so its time for a protein treatment. I usually use Aphogee 2 min 1x a month. After doing more research on it, a protein treatment should be left on the hair for 15-20mins in length as opposed to 2 mins. Plus when I used ApHogee, my breakage wouldn't stop completely...there were still a couple broken hairs after the treatment. I didn't want to use this again.

With that being said, I remembered Traycee's protein treatment where she uses an egg, a cheap conditioner, leaves it on for 15 minutes. I was attracted to that since it seemed so simple and easy. With my mix, I used 1 egg, Aussie Moist conditioner (put enough to cover the entire egg in the bowl) and 3 tsp of EVOO.



<--Before After-->

This mix can be runny so be careful while applying. I left it on for 15 mins with a plastic cap (no heat), rinsed and followed up with my DPR/AtOne Mix for 30mins w/ heat (lovess it).

As my hair was air drying it felt sooooooo soft, noticeably thicker, very poofy and I had more waves in my hair than normal. Once my hair was dry, I moisturized and sealed, no broken hairs in my hand, nothing!! My hair felt much stronger and was retaining moisture evern better than before. I was so happy. After that I styled my hair & went out. I will be doing this treatment 1-2x/month now.
